  <abstract>System dynamics is a heuristic modeling tool for studying real world problems and  analyzing their behavior under different real and simulated conditions. Furthermore, behavioral  patterns are generated identifying past performance and inferred future possibilities. On the  basis of this analysis experimentation is done through simulated policies to recommend  strategies for problem rectification.  Pakistan Railways is a state owned enterprise planning, monitoring and controlling the  railway network of Pakistan. Currently, Pakistan Railways is under large debt with poor  service delivery. This has instigating a problematic situation further burden due to a lack of  financial investment in its operations.  This study uses system dynamics as a modeling tool to simulated the problematic  situation of Pakistan Railways and through model experimentation and analysis recommends  different operational policies to improve the problematic situation of Pakistan Railways.  Conclusion derived from the model indicates that appropriate operational policies for Pakistan  Railways to improve its future operations would constitute construction of double line with  increased provision for maintenance capacities of rolling stock as well as lines.</abstract>
